Noida: A shooting incident was reported at the house of RLD leader Somendra Awana in Nithari village, located in the Sector 20 area of Noida. Following the firing, the suspect fled the scene, but the police acted promptly and have detained him. The incident is believed to be linked to a dispute over money, and the police are now investigating the matter.Why Did the Shooting Occur?Somendra Awana is an RLD leader, and he along with his brother Amit Awana provide internet connection services. Their cable connection runs near the home of the accused, Sanjay Awana, who also uses this network. Amit went to Sanjay’s house to fix the cable and collect an outstanding bill, during which a disagreement over the payment escalated.Panic after the shootingThe dispute became so heated that Sanjay Awana went to the house of Somendra and Amit Awana and began firing. Fortunately, no injuries were reported, but the shooting caused a great deal of panic in the area.Arrest of the suspectUpon receiving reports of the shooting, the Sector 20 police quickly arrived at the scene and began their investigation. They arrested Sanjay Awana immediately. The Noida police have stated that a thorough investigation is underway, and strict legal action will be taken against the suspect. According to the Noida Police Commissionerate, the Sector 20 police are treating this case seriously and are reviewing all the details to ensure further action is taken soon.
